Grilled lemon chicken is marinated in just 5 simple ingredients but comes out incredibly flavorful! Serve as is or use for wraps, grain bowls and salads.

Yield: 4servings
Ingredients
1 ½lbs.boneless, skinless chicken breasts
⅓cupextra-virgin olive oil
⅓cupfresh squeezed lemon juice (from about 3 lemons)
2clovesgarlic, minced
1 ½teaspoonskosher salt
¾teaspoonblack pepper
1tablespoonchopped fresh thyme OR parsley (see notes)
Instructions
Place the chicken breasts into a large ziploc bag or a large bowl.
In a small bowl, whisk together the olive oil, lemon juice, garlic, salt, pepper and fresh herbs until well combined. Pour the marinade mixture into the bag with the chicken. Seal the bag and turn to get the chicken breasts well coated.
Refrigerate the chicken and let marinate for 4-6 hours, turning occasionally.
Remove the chicken from the refrigerator then preheat the grill to medium high.
Remove the chicken from the bag and discard the marinade.
Grill the chicken breasts for 7-8 minutes then flip and grill for another 4-5 minutes, until cooked through.

Notes
The recipe calls for fresh thyme or fresh parsley; use whichever you have. I’ve also made this without the fresh herbs before and it was still really good.We’re using boneless, skinless chicken breasts, but you could substitute chicken thighs if you prefer. Just be sure to watch the cook time and check that they cook through.Fresh lemon juice is a must here; don’t substitute the bottled stuff.No grill? No problem. You can make this inside on a grill pan or in a regular sauté pan in a pinch.Don't have 4-6 hours to marinade this chicken? Let it sit in the marinade, at room temperature, for 30 minutes then throw it on the grill. It won't have the full flavor, but it'll do in a pinch.
